| Career Role in Water Preservation | Description |
|---|---|
| Water Conservation Officer (Water Management, Sustainability) | Develops and implements water conservation strategies for organizations and communities. High demand in the UK due to increasing water scarcity. |
| Environmental Consultant (Water) (Environmental Science, Water Resources) | Provides expert advice on water-related environmental issues, conducting assessments and recommending solutions. Growing market due to stricter environmental regulations. |
| Hydrologist (Water Science, Hydrology) | Studies the movement, distribution, and quality of water on Earth. Essential for water resource management, particularly in drought-prone regions. |
| Water Engineer (Water Engineering, Civil Engineering) | Designs, builds, and maintains water infrastructure. A key role in ensuring safe and reliable water supplies. |
